Craft Beer Bar & Bottle Shop Progress in Musashi-Kosugi announced its service for Wednesday, June 10, from 16:00 to 23:00.

In the post, the shop said the previous day was busy despite being a weekday, and noted that it is now entering its fourth year. The message has a calm, everyday tone: Progress wants to keep moving forward as a neighborhood craft beer stop, whether the day is slow or busy.

The key beer update is “Trinity Session,” an anniversary beer brewed with TKBrewing. The full 30 liters were sold through by the end of the previous day, so the beer is temporarily out of stock. The team says it is working on getting it back on tap as soon as possible. Some of the beers selected for the anniversary have already finished as well, but several others are still lined up.

Progress is a casual beer pub and bottle shop, and it is also easy to use for takeaway. Draft beer to go is 20% off every Wednesday and Thursday, and the shop can provide cups or PET bottles if you do not bring a growler.
